How does RemoteToPC pricing compare to ISL Online?
RemoteToPC Basic is $99 per year for up to 10 computers. ISL Online’s current Starter plan is $16.90 per month billed annually for one licensed user and 10 managed devices, while Standard is positioned for larger teams and device counts.
What is the difference between RemoteToPC and ISL Online licensing?
RemoteToPC primarily prices by the number of computers. ISL Online uses plan tiers with licensed-user, concurrent-user, and managed-device limits; higher tiers expand user counts, device allowances, customization, and hosting choices.
Do RemoteToPC and ISL Online support unattended remote access?
Yes. Both platforms support unattended remote access. ISL Online uses its ISL AlwaysOn agent for permanent access and includes computer grouping, sharing, access history, and access-control features.
Which offers better monitoring and IT management tools?
RemoteToPC IT plans include real-time device monitoring and alerts, advanced system information, and practical management tools. ISL Online provides reports, access history, and email notifications for remote-access events, but those features are not the same as endpoint-health monitoring.
Can multiple users access remote computers with both products?
Yes. RemoteToPC supports multiple users on team-oriented plans. ISL Online Standard lists 40 licensed users, while Premium and larger offerings support substantially more users subject to plan and fair-usage terms.
